Solution

The correct option is B B<A<C
The object that completely sinks in water has more density than the water. So, C has the highest density among the three objects.

A and B are floating, so their density is lower than water. Among A and B, larger fraction of A is immersed in water as compared to B. So, A has higher density than B.

So, arranging the bodies in the decreaing order of densities, we get the following order:
B<A<C
